How far is St Petersburg, FL, from Sioux City, IA?

The distance between Sioux City (Sioux Gateway Airport) and St Petersburg (St. Pete–Clearwater International Airport) is 1261 miles / 2030 kilometers / 1096 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Sioux City (SUX) to St Petersburg (PIE) is 1547 miles / 2489 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 28 hours 28 minutes.

Distance from Sioux City to St Petersburg

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Sioux City to St Petersburg.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1261.166 miles
  • 2029.651 kilometers
  • 1095.924 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1261.907 miles
  • 2030.842 kilometers
  • 1096.567 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Sioux City to St Petersburg?

The estimated flight time from Sioux Gateway Airport to St. Pete–Clearwater International Airport is 2 hours and 53 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between Sioux Gateway Airport (SUX) and St. Pete–Clearwater International Airport (PIE)

On average, flying from Sioux City to St Petersburg generates about 164 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 164 kilograms equals 362 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
